NO! Warren Wallace is a character created by Geico for their advertisments, who is played by a child actor named Eddie Heffernan. Eddie has, however, actually began partisipating in racing though, and even has the "warren wallace" name on his midget/mod car, which is sponsored by Geico. While Geico will no longer sponsor Mike Wallace in the Nationwide Series in 2009(Nascar has forced them out to appease Series Title-Sponsor Nationwide Insurance), they will keep Eddie on as "Warren Wallace" in television ads alongside the driver that they'll sponsor part-time in Sprint Cup; Max Papis.
